Backgrounds & Facts
To understand the necessity of Layer 2 solutions, we must first grasp the core principles of Bitcoin's Layer 1. The original Bitcoin blockchain is a marvel of engineering, designed for ultimate security and decentralization. Every transaction is recorded on a public ledger, verified by a global network of miners, and bundled into blocks roughly every ten minutes. This robust, immutable process ensures trust without intermediaries, but it comes at a cost: limited transaction throughput, typically around 7 transactions per second (TPS).
When network demand exceeds this capacity, transactions queue up, and users must pay higher fees to incentivize miners to include their transactions in the next block. This often renders Bitcoin impractical for everyday micro-payments or time-sensitive commercial activities. This challenge has been evident since Bitcoin's early days, prompting developers to explore 'off-chain' scaling solutions.
Layer 2 solutions are protocols built on top of the main Bitcoin blockchain (Layer 1) that process transactions separately, only interacting with Layer 1 for final settlement or dispute resolution. Think of it like a highway system: Layer 1 is the main, secure, but slow highway, while Layer 2s are faster, more efficient express lanes or local roads that connect back to the main highway when needed. This approach allows for massive increases in transaction speed and dramatic reductions in fees, all while inheriting the foundational security of Bitcoin's Layer 1.
Early pioneers like the Lightning Network demonstrated the potential for instant, low-cost payments. By 2026, the landscape has matured significantly, with diverse Layer 2s catering to different use cases – from retail payments and institutional transfers to smart contracts and complex DeFi applications. 💰 Best Options in Comparison (VERY IMPORTANT)
Navigating the burgeoning Bitcoin Layer 2 landscape can be daunting, but understanding the key players is crucial for optimizing your Bitcoin usage and investment strategy. Here are the leading solutions making waves in 2026:
-
Lightning Network
The most established and widely adopted Layer 2 for micro-payments. Lightning creates off-chain payment channels between users, allowing for virtually instant, near-zero-fee transactions. It's ideal for everyday spending, streaming money, and small transfers. While setup can be slightly technical, user-friendly wallets are making it increasingly accessible for everyone looking to spend Bitcoin efficiently.
-
Liquid Network
Developed by Blockstream, Liquid is a federated sidechain designed for faster, confidential Bitcoin transfers and the issuance of new digital assets. It uses a 'federated peg' where a consortium of trusted members secures the network. Liquid is primarily geared towards institutional traders, exchanges, and financial applications requiring rapid, high-volume BTC settlements and the ability to issue tokenized securities or stablecoins (like L-BTC or Tether on Liquid).
-
Stacks (STX)
Stacks brings smart contracts and decentralized applications directly to Bitcoin. It uses a unique consensus mechanism called Proof-of-Transfer (PoX), where Stacks miners commit BTC to the Bitcoin blockchain, and STX holders earn BTC rewards. This allows DApps, NFTs, and DeFi protocols to leverage Bitcoin's security without modifying its core protocol. Stacks is perfect for developers and users looking to engage with a vibrant Web3 ecosystem built on Bitcoin.
-
Rootstock (RSK)
Rootstock is an EVM-compatible smart contract platform secured by merged mining with Bitcoin. This means Bitcoin miners can simultaneously mine RSK blocks, securing both networks. RSK allows developers to easily port Ethereum-based DApps to Bitcoin's security model, offering a familiar environment for DeFi and other smart contract applications. Its native token, RBTC, is pegged 1:1 to BTC, enabling Bitcoin to be used within its ecosystem.
Comparative Overview of Leading Bitcoin Layer 2 Solutions (2026)
| Feature | Lightning Network | Liquid Network | Stacks (STX) | Rootstock (RSK) |
|---|---|---|---|---|
| Purpose | Micropayments, instant transactions | Faster, confidential BTC transfers, token issuance | Smart contracts, DApps, NFTs on Bitcoin | EVM-compatible smart contracts, DeFi |
| Security Model | Payment Channels, Layer 1 settlement | Federated Peg (Blockstream members) | Proof-of-Transfer (PoX) with BTC | Merged Mining with BTC |
| Transaction Speed | Instant (milliseconds) | ~1 minute | ~10-30 minutes (block time) | ~30 seconds (block time) |
| Transaction Fees | Very Low | Low | Moderate (STX gas fees) | Moderate (RBTC gas fees) |
| Decentralization | High (peer-to-peer channels) | Moderate (federated) | Moderate (dependent on PoX miners) | Moderate (dependent on merged miners) |
| Key Use Cases | Retail payments, streaming money, small transfers | Institutional trading, stablecoins, security tokens | DeFi, NFTs, Web3 apps directly on Bitcoin | DeFi, dApps, stablecoins, porting EVM apps |
| Best For | Everyday spending, small transfers, rapid payments | Large, fast BTC transfers, asset issuance, institutional use | Building DApps and engaging with Web3 on Bitcoin | Developers and users seeking EVM compatibility with Bitcoin's security |
